Restore files and system settings after a virus or malware

When using a Windows PC, it can happen to run into various problems, from the disappearance of the icons to the inability to launch some programs to the unavailability of some control or verification tools.
When there are errors of this type, the causes may have been:
- a virus which, even if removed, has nevertheless modified some settings or hidden some tools;
- an error of the user who, by mistake or ignorance, has deleted some files or has played imprudently with the registry keys or advanced system settings;
- a poorly designed program of those that promise to "optimize the system", instead ruining the stability of the system.
In any case, without going crazy looking for errors, there are some automatic repair tools developed specifically to restore the functions of a Windows computer after a virus attack .

The best developers at making virus removal programs collect every program on the Bleeping Computer site, the best one where to find reliable programs for the cure of Windows when it shows problems or errors of various kinds.
Some Bleeping Computer tools such as rKill (tool to close the processes started by a malware mentioned in all the malware removal guides) are absolutely to be kept in the drawer because they are unique and life-saving.
From Bleeping computer you can download other tools such as, for example:
- Unhide: to return Windows icons if they disappeared from the desktop.
- FixExec if you are unable to run multiple EXE files or BAT files and, therefore, you can no longer open programs on Windows.
- MiniToolBox to restore all network functions in case of connectivity problems.
Among the various recommended programs is also Windows Repair All in one, a free Tweaking.com software to repair and solve problems of a Windows PC .
The program is all in English but still remains the best of its kind.
Upon opening, you can follow the 4 preliminary steps to follow before making system repairs .
In particular, it is said to:
1) Scan with Malwarebytes Anti-malware to make sure there are no viruses on your computer.
2) Do the scandisk to check errors on the disk: from Windows Repair to card 2 of the check disk, press the Do iT key.
3) Restoring Windows system files .
In the case of Windows XP it is necessary to insert the installation CD in the drive before pressing the Do it button, while for Vista Windows 7 and 8 it is not necessary.
4) Create a restore point and backup the registry before making repairs.
This is important because, if after using Windows Repair the problems were not solved and, indeed, there were new ones (you cannot guarantee that everything works magically), you can restore Windows as it was before.
5) Start Repairs tab, press the Start button to begin repairs.

At this point Windows Repair shows all the interventions it is ready to do which, roughly speaking, are all function restorations and corrections of parts of the system that could be corrupt.
Each type of repair can be selected or not, depending on what you need.
Without making the complete list, Windows Repair is capable of :
- Reset the registry permissions
- Restore file permissions
- Register system files
- Restore Windows Firewall
- Reset Internet Explorer
- Repairing the Hosts File
- Remove security policies set by the virus.
- Repair Icons
- Repair Winsock & DNS cache
- Delete temporary files
- Proxy reset
- Make the system files visible again
- Repair of Windows Updates
- Make the CD or DVD icon visible again
- Repair Windows Installer
- Restore the default startup settings of the services
- Restore safe mode.
After selecting the tasks to be performed, press the Start button and wait for the work to finish.
Restart the computer and everything should be solved, unless the problems were of a different nature.
Windows Repair is perhaps the most complete suite of tools to restore Windows functions, which works with Windows 7, Windows 8, XP and other versions.
